The Alberni Valley straddles Highway 4 on Vancouver Island, from the east end of Cameron Lake to the western tip of Sproat Lake. It encompasses Mt Arrowsmith, Cameron Lake, Cathedral Grove, MacMillan Provincial Park, the City of Port Alberni, and Sproat Lake (including Taylor Arm Provincial Park and Fossil Provincial Park. The terrain of the area is diverse, including low-lying areas around the north end of the Alberni inlet, primeval rainforests, wild mountain regions, and Mt Arrowsmith, the highest peak (elevation 1,819 m) on Southern Vancouver Island.
